    Briefly, Nov. 17, 2010

    SOUTH BERWICK LIBRARY PATRONS can now download more than 1,100 e-book titles to their home computers via a Maine Libraries Consortium program. The online collection contains about 1,800 titles. Visit www. south-berwick.lib.me.us and use the “download library” link. Information on how to use the system is available through an easy-to-use tutorial. For details, call 384-3308. […]
